0 reports about 2564666915The number was first reported 2nd Aug, 2025
Received a phone call from 2564666915? Report here
File a report about 2564666915 |
Phone Number Variations: 2564666915, 02564-666915, 912564666915, 002564666915, 1912564666915, +1912564666915